Crawl Space Solutions
In our area, many of the homes were built with crawl spaces in addition to basements. For a long time, these were constructed with vents to the outside where were intended to help fresh air flow through the area and keep it dry. Unfortunately, the opposite is usually what happens. The vents allow water to get in when it rains or snows and the vents prevent proper evaporation which results in the humidity level staying too high which can facilitate the growth of mildew. Up to ½ of the air in your home has come up through the crawl space so having the space protected from the weather and keeping the humidity levels low can improve the overall air quality in your home.
We have been dealing with crawl spaces since we opened our doors and we know the most efficient way to close them off and control excess humidity. This is done using a process called encapsulation which is the installation of a heavy duty liner, occasionally installed with insulation products, and are sturdy plastic and vinyl sheeting as well as covers to close off existing vents and a heavy duty door that can close off the area completely and prevent any unwanted moisture from entering. Encapsulation will also prevent bugs and animals from settling in the crawl space which will help keep any equipment there safe and allow you to use it for storage. After your crawl space is closed off, if necessary we can install a series of floor jacks to stabilize sagging floors above the crawl space.
Structural Foundation Repair
The foundation of your home is quite possibly one of, if not the, most important parts. It not only holds the structure itself but it also creates the basement walls. When you have any foundation problems, they will generally manifest themselves as diagonal cracks in your brickwork, cracks that run along the foundation or across the basement walls. Sometimes, you will see that your doors or windows will not open or close easily or even cracks at the corners of them. While these issues may not seem critical at first, each of them are indicators of a sinking or settling foundation and it is important to have an expert evaluate the foundation for particular problems to determine if a repair needs to be in place.
Thankfully, the most common foundation problems have very similar causes and our experts are very good at spotting those issues. We can offer a repair product intended for your specific issue to permanently repair and stabilize the foundation. If you have a sloping foundation, we can install a series of foundation piers to level the foundation. The location and amount of sinking will determine if we use helical or push piers. Both types of piers are very strong and can help stabilize your foundation.
